Anthropic Releases Claude Fable 5.1 With 75% Cache Cost Cut

Anthropic released Claude Fable 5.1 and Mythos 5.1, its latest flagship models for coding and knowledge work, while slashing cached token pricing by 75%. The update targets enterprises running AI agents on complex, multi-step tasks involving sensitive data.

Fable 5.1 is generally available with built-in safeguards, while Mythos 5.1 is restricted to approved cybersecurity and life-sciences organizations via a trusted-access program. Both models share the same underlying architecture but differ in safety restrictions.

The company claims Fable 5.1 delivers stronger performance on software projects, code reviews, and multistep scientific workflows. It also helps design experiments and interpret detailed tables and diagrams.

On internal benchmarks, Fable 5.1 scored 55.8% on Terminal-Bench 4.0, up from 42% for Fable 5. Mythos 5.1 reached 60.9% under relaxed safety settings. On Terminal-Bench-Science 0.1, Fable 5.1 achieved 52.6%, more than double Fable 5's 24.7%.

Pricing changes include a 25% reduction for typical workloads and up to 45% for heavily agentic tasks. Cache reads now cost $0.25 per million tokens, down from $1. Base input and output rates remain at $10 and $50 per million tokens respectively.

Anthropic also introduced Enterprise Frontier Safeguards (EFS), letting customers store data on their own infrastructure. EFS rolls out this fall across Claude Code, Claude Enterprise, and major cloud platforms.

In scientific testing, Mythos 5.1 reportedly designed high-affinity protein binders with a 50% hit rate across 12 targets. Fable 5.1 helped build a new elevation map covering a third of Venus's surface using NASA Magellan data.

These benchmark results are Anthropic's own and should not be treated as independent proof of superiority.

The market reaction has been cautious, with developers weighing cost savings against safety trade-offs. Early adopters are testing Mythos 5.1 in controlled environments.

For practitioners, the real test lies in how these models perform under extended agentic workloads. Cost efficiency gains may drive adoption, but trust in safety controls remains key.

FAQ

Q: What is the difference between Fable 5.1 and Mythos 5.1?

A: They share the same architecture. Fable 5.1 has standard safeguards and is publicly available. Mythos 5.1 has fewer restrictions but is limited to trusted-access programs.

Q: How much did cache pricing drop?

A: Cache read costs fell 75%, from $1 to $0.25 per million tokens.

Q: Are the benchmark scores independently verified?

A: No. All scores cited by Anthropic are self-reported and not independently validated.

Q: When will Enterprise Frontier Safeguards launch?

A: EFS begins rolling out this fall across Claude Code, Claude Enterprise, and AWS, Google Cloud, and Microsoft Azure.
